We’re looking for a motivated and curious Data Platform Engineer to join our Data Foundations team and help build, operate, and evolve the internal data platforms that power analytics, data science, and emerging AI workflows across King.

With over 65 petabytes of data and 130+ billion events generated every day, data is at the heart of King’s business. The Game Platform Data organisation, distributed across Barcelona, London, and Stockholm, is responsible for ingesting, processing, and exposing this data in a reliable, scalable, and usable way. You will be part of the Data Foundations team, owning and operating the shared data platforms and services used by hundreds of practitioners across the company.

Responsibilities

  • Help operate, monitor, and maintain shared data platforms and services, ensuring reliability and performance for data engineering, analytics, and data science workflows.
  • Contribute to the operation and administration of third‑party platforms, including configuration, access management, upgrades, and extensions with integrations and tooling to meet internal needs.
  • Contribute to platform lifecycle activities such as upgrades, dependency management, and improvements to stability, security, and scalability.
  • Build and improve automation, tooling, and services in Python to support platform operations, user workflows, and emerging use cases.
  • Assist in integrating internal and external systems, enabling seamless data, metadata, and workflow connectivity across platforms.
  • Work with more experienced engineers to design and implement scalable and maintainable solutions, learning best practices along the way.
  • Collaborate with data scientists, analysts, and data engineers to understand their needs and help improve the platforms they rely on.
  • Support the development of reusable components, libraries, and patterns that improve consistency and developer experience across shared platforms.
  • Participate in incident response, debugging, and operational support to diagnose and resolve issues in production systems.
  • Contribute to documentation, code reviews, and knowledge sharing, building your skills while supporting a strong engineering culture.

Required Qualifications

  • At least two years of professional experience in a relevant field such as platform engineering, software engineering, or data engineering.
  • Familiarity with cloud platforms such as GCP, AWS, or Azure.
  • Experience with CI/CD pipelines, version control, and basic DevOps practices.
  • Experience with infrastructure as code tools such as Terraform or Crossplane.
  • Experience supporting or operating production systems.
  • Good understanding of containers (Docker) and orchestration (Kubernetes).
  • Strong interest in data platforms and how data is used across organisations.
  • Willingness to learn from others and develop new skills across different domains.
  • Excellent communication skills and a collaborative, customer‑focused mindset.
